Abstract

The paper deals with the legal aspects of the problems of labor migration and human trafficking, its causes and factors, the trafficking scale. When considering economic causes, we refer to the demand for low-cost labor, as a characteristic factor of globalization which, in turn, greatly effects the international labor migration and is one of the root causes of human trafficking. In the analysis of the social causes, the focus is mainly made on the low-pay employment or lack of working conditions.
